关闭DELPHI(100)

  • 主题发起人 主题发起人 lengyan69
  • 开始时间 开始时间
L

lengyan69

Unregistered / Unconfirmed
GUEST, unregistred user!
我在关闭DELPHI时有时会出现access violation at address 02BA1C10.read of address 02BA1C10错误,请问是怎么回事,如何解决
 
你开了多个Delphi吧?~~
 
没有,倒是开了许多别的窗口,有时直接运行一下DELPHI的可执行文件,然后关闭,跟我的程序没关系吧,每次编译运行程序没问题,关闭DELPHI就出现上述错误
 
有对像没有释放掉吧,或者是释放了没有创建的对像估计是
 
你自己程序里面的问题,因为Delphi调式的时候嵌入到了你的程序中 DebugHook技术,所以你的程序出现内存紊乱那么退出Delphi的时候就会出现,有的时候甚至查找都会报错,呵呵!
 
那我的程序单独运行又没出错呢
 
什么查找报错
 
是不是程序太大了?我们公司的程序太大了,经常报各种各样的错误。
 
可能你装了三方控件,兼容性不好
 
地址错误,反应此类型错误太多了,很多原因造成:如隐形对象未释放,基本上程序的隐形错误造成的。这个需要对程序有比较深刻的了解才行,其它等。
 
这个问题也经常遇到,以前也查询过原因,至今无具体答案;不过大致是因为delphi关闭时保存当前环境时地址错误了,第三方控件的引用,同时打开多个开发环境都可以导致发生;不过不影响正常程序运行的,不深究也罢;
 
后退
顶部